Python字符串格式化输出语法有哪些总结?

2026-05-24 16:150阅读0评论SEO问题
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1120个文字,预计阅读时间需要5分钟。

Python字符串格式化输出语法有哪些总结?

1. 引言:在程序设计中,字符串处理是一个不可或缺的工作。对于字符串的常见操作,Python 内置了各种不同的工具。本文将重点讨论 Python 中关于字符串格式化输出的各种语法。

2. 旧式语法

Python字符串格式化输出语法有哪些总结?

1. 引言

在程序设计中,对于字符串的处理是个免不了的工作。对于字符串的常见操作,Python内置了各种不同的工具,本篇要讨论的是关于Python中字串格式化输出的各种语法。

2. 旧式语法

在Python中最早的方式是使用符号​​%​​来设定格式化字符串。例如下面的方式:

person = 'Sean'
print("My name is %s" %person)

旧式的语法使用​​%​​符号来告诉Python编译器此处需要替换成字符串。并且到下一个​​%​​符号处找到变量person,并且将变量person的值带入第一个​​%​​符号中。

大家可以发现第一个​​%​​符号后面跟着一个s字母。这个字母代表的是字符串类型。下面列出其他可以转换的类型:

3. 新式语法--format

这里的新旧式语法的区分,是以​​Python 3​​作为划分的时间点。Python 3中引进了这种新式的语法。新式语法丢掉了原先的​​%​​符号,改用​​format()​​方法在字串中插入变量,使用时需要搭配花括号进行标识。

阅读全文

本文共计1120个文字,预计阅读时间需要5分钟。

Python字符串格式化输出语法有哪些总结?

1. 引言:在程序设计中,字符串处理是一个不可或缺的工作。对于字符串的常见操作,Python 内置了各种不同的工具。本文将重点讨论 Python 中关于字符串格式化输出的各种语法。

2. 旧式语法

Python字符串格式化输出语法有哪些总结?

1. 引言

在程序设计中,对于字符串的处理是个免不了的工作。对于字符串的常见操作,Python内置了各种不同的工具,本篇要讨论的是关于Python中字串格式化输出的各种语法。

2. 旧式语法

在Python中最早的方式是使用符号​​%​​来设定格式化字符串。例如下面的方式:

person = 'Sean'
print("My name is %s" %person)

旧式的语法使用​​%​​符号来告诉Python编译器此处需要替换成字符串。并且到下一个​​%​​符号处找到变量person,并且将变量person的值带入第一个​​%​​符号中。

大家可以发现第一个​​%​​符号后面跟着一个s字母。这个字母代表的是字符串类型。下面列出其他可以转换的类型:

3. 新式语法--format

这里的新旧式语法的区分,是以​​Python 3​​作为划分的时间点。Python 3中引进了这种新式的语法。新式语法丢掉了原先的​​%​​符号,改用​​format()​​方法在字串中插入变量,使用时需要搭配花括号进行标识。

阅读全文